October 29, 2015 BIR RULING NO. 388-15 Sec. 101 (A) (3) of the Tax Code of 1997; BIR Ruling No. 221-14 Davao Mission of Seventh-Day Adventist Church, Inc. 5 Palm Drive, Bajada, Davao City Attention: Pastor Jerry C. Patalinghug President-Davao Mission Gentlemen : This refers to your letter dated January 6, 2015 requesting exemption from donor's tax relative to the donation of a parcel of land executed to the Davao Mission of Seventh-Day Adventist Church, Inc. Documents submitted show that Liliosa Bariarcal and Marvalito Bariarcal married to Edna Bariarcal (hereinafter referred to as Landowners) are the registered owners of a parcel of land, identified as Lot 15-A, Psd-11-117336 being a portion of Lot 15, Pcs-11-005248 covered by Transfer Certificate of Title (TCT) No. 142-2012006358 issued by the Registry of Deeds for Province of Davao del Norte. The aforesaid property is situated at Brgy. Poblacion, Maragusan, Compostela Valley with an area of Five Thousand square meters (5,000 sq.m.), more or less. And has no improvement thereon. Davao Mission of Seventh-Day Adventist Church, Inc. (TIN 001-378-221-000), on the other hand, is a religious corporation duly registered with the SEC with Company Registration No. CN201231373 dated September 4, 2012, principally for the purpose of administering the Seventh-Day Adventist Church's temporalities and the management of its properties and estates only. The Treasurer of Davao Mission of Seventh-Day Adventist Church, Inc. has certified that its trustees do not receive any compensation or remuneration in their capacity as such. On March 3, 2014, the landowners, executed a Deed of Donation in favor of the Davao Mission of Seventh-Day Adventist Church, Inc. over the above-mentioned parcel of land, subject to the condition that the donated property shall be used exclusively for the establishment of Church and religious building/s of the Donee or any other institution/facility of the Seventh-Day Adventist Church, educational and medical institutions, socio-civic and other religious and educational purposes by the Davao Mission of Seventh-Day Adventist Church, Inc. In reply, please be informed that Section 101 (A) (3) of the Tax Code of 1997, as amended, provides that: "SEC. 101. Exemption of Certain Gifts. The following gifts or donations shall be exempt from the tax provided for in this Chapter: xxx xxx xxx (A) In the Case of Gifts Made by a Resident xxx xxx xxx (3) Gifts in favor of an educational and/or charitable, religious, cultural or social welfare corporation, institution, accredited nongovernment organization, trust or philanthropic organization or research institution or organization: Provided, however, That not more than thirty percent (30%) of said gifts shall be used by such donee for administration purposes. For the purpose of this exemption, a 'non-profit educational and/or charitable corporation, institution, accredited nongovernment organization, trust or philanthropic organization and/or research institution or organization' is a school, college or university and/or charitable corporation, accredited nongovernment organization, trust or philanthropic organization and/or research institution or organization, incorporated as a non-stock entity, paying no dividends, governed by trustees who receive no compensation, and devoting all its income, whether student's fees or gifts, donation, subsidies or other forms of philanthropy, to the accomplishment and promotion of the purposes enumerated in its Articles of Incorporation. ICHDca xxx xxx xxx In view of the foregoing, since the donation is made to or for the use of Davao Mission of Seventh-Day Adventist Church, Inc., a religious corporation, which pays no dividends, and governed by trustees who do not receive any compensation, the aforementioned donation by Liliosa Bariarcal and Marvalito Bariarcal married to Edna Bariarcal of a parcel of land without improvement covered by TCT No. 142-2012006358, situated in Brgy. Poblacion, Maragusan, Compostela Valley is exempt from the payment of donor's tax pursuant to Section 101 (A) (3) of the Tax Code of 1997, as amended, provided, however, that not more than 30% of the gifts shall be used by the donee for administration purposes. (BIR Ruling No. 221-2014 dated June 20, 2014) Moreover, Section 185 of Regulations No. 26, otherwise known as the Revised Documentary Stamp Tax Regulations, implementing Title VII of the Tax Code, provides that conveyances of realties not in connection with a sale, to trustees or other persons without consideration are not taxable. Accordingly, the deed of donation is not subject to the documentary stamp tax prescribed under Section 196 of the Tax Code, as amended, but only to the documentary stamp tax of P15.00 imposed under Section 188 of the same Code. (BIR Ruling No. 221-2014 dated June 20, 2014) This ruling is being issued on the basis of the foregoing facts as represented. However, if upon investigation it will be disclosed that the facts are different, then this ruling shall be considered null and void. Very truly yours, (SGD.) KIM S.
